The addition of too much organic make any difference which has an excessive amount of carbon rather than sufficient nitrogen can deplete the soil of nitrogen and hurt plant growth. As an example, if you try to Enhance the organic matter of the soil by tilling in bales of straw or sawdust (equally of which might be Just about all cellulose, that's very superior in carbon), once the microbes start to split the straw down they need to soak up nitrogen within the soil just for their very own growth.

Nitrogen is a vital factor present in protein, phosphorus is a vital component in energy transfer molecules like ATP and as Component of the Agricultural economics DNA backbone, and potassium is A vital Component of the mechanism for transferring nutrients into and outside of cells. Other components will also be significant in compact portions As well as in Unique situation, but N, P, and K are the most typical plant nutrients.
